Day 7Iguazu FallsBreakfast at the hotel. Visit the Argentinian side of Iguazu Falls by taking the train to the 'Devil's Throat' where a lookout area grants the opportunity to watch the water rush from the river and down a 262 feet high sheer drop. Walk across bridges and enjoy the panoramic views on offer. Hear the roar of water whilst taking in the spectacular views of rainbows, birds, leafy green exotic plants and trees. * Return to the hotel for an overnight stay. * Optional Iguazu Great Adventure Excursion: Enter the jungle by the Yacaratiá trail in trucks specially designed for this environment. This 3 mile-long stretch ends at Puerto Macuco. At the dock, board a boat that sails into the Lower Iguazu River for up to 3.7 miles, heading towards the waterfalls. Upon reaching the Tres Mosqueteros Fall, see the falls of both the Argentinian and Brazilian sides crowned by the view of the Garganta del Diablo (Devil’s Throat). Afterwards, the most exciting point comes when facing the incomparable San Martín waterfall. Together, they make up the largest waterfall system in the world. The falls divide the river into the upper and lower Iguazu. If you choose to take the optional, it will replace a part of the included tour on this day. Please note: You will not be able to take part in the Great Adventure excursion if you have any heart problems, have had any kind of heart surgery or if you have any physical disabilities.
